Marmon Renew is a global leader in beverage and food service equipment remanufacturing. Our commitment to quality, ability to meet specific customer needs, and provide ‘like new’ equipment at a reduced cost provides an immediate value proposition to our customers.
As part of the Engineering team, the Manufacturing Engineer is responsible for the development and implementation of manufacturing processes on new and existing products to achieve an optimum relationship between cost and quality. This position covers process engineering, industrial engineering, production standard costs, tooling/equipment procurement, improving operating performance, waste reduction, supporting new product evaluation, onboarding, and troubleshooting. The Manufacturing Engineer ensures effective quality system implementation to prevent defects and supports continuous improvement using lean manufacturing concepts.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Evaluate and develop manufacturing processes for new and existing products to optimize cost and quality.
Design work centers and product/process flow, considering ergonomic, lean manufacturing, mechanical, electrical, and changeover aspects.
Assess new equipment models and develop processing plans and standard work for production.
Lead lean manufacturing initiatives, including strategy development, employee training, and kaizen events.
Reduce scrap, rework, material and labor variances, and evaluate safety and ergonomic factors.
Collaborate with staff to meet performance goals and maintain support functions.
Coordinate with the Plant Manager to ensure policy and objective conformance.
Plan and monitor capital projects related to tooling, equipment, and automation.
Maintain production layouts, routings, work standards, and work instructions.
Support mechanical and electrical repairs and develop maintenance instructions.
Create sampling plans, quality standards, and process control instructions.
Engage with customers to identify process and product improvements and corrective actions.
